Plotters - Some Basic Things You Need to Know
A plotter is a kind of computer printer which is mainly used in the printing of vector graphics. In the early days, the main use of the plotters were in the various computer aided designs or CADs. But, with time, large format conventional printers replaced them all together. By mistake and for habit, still a lot of people call these conventional printers as plotters.
Unlike a conventional printer, a plotter uses line drawing to create the output.
In a conventional printer, dots are used in general. If you are aiming to create banners or layouts, then the best option is to go for a plotter. A plotter might have an internal computer or it can be added to an existing computer. It all depends upon the type of work and the budget of the users.

If you are aiming to create an image containing more than one color, then multiple pens and pencils need to be used in the plotter for best results. Plotters are preferable for engineering projects or architectural projects.
Small businesses might find it difficult to buy a plotter for cost reasons.
The usage level won’t be much higher in a small scale business. Large scale businesses can easily afford one. But, professional manpower is required to handle a plotter. Therefore, before buying a plotter for your organization, you must ensure the presence of quality manpower to maintain and run it in a smooth manner.
